Normal Range And Extended Range VLANs

You can say that VLANs, as the available range for them has expanded as networks got bigger and more complex. Reference the table below to see the VLAN ranges.
VLAN Range | IDs |
---|---|
Normal Range | 1-1001 |
Extended Range | 1006-4094 |
One thing to keep in mind is VTP version 1 and 2 don’t support extended VLANs. Only VTP version 3 supports extend VLANs. You may also notice that VLANs 1002-1005 are reserved for legacy technologies like token ring and FDDI. As well as beware depending on some Cisco devices like NX-OS has some of the higher VLAN IDs reserved.
